)]}'
{
  "commit": "fa06a731b989f5bd81edca5afb00e767cebad827",
  "tree": "28d65a89e8fc05ad64ded40f5ffdbecd8334ec30",
  "parents": [
    "349b5f07231f96bffe1acb6c24c1749d5442217c"
  ],
  "author": {
    "name": "Jacek Centkowski",
    "email": "geminica.programs@gmail.com",
    "time": "Fri Feb 04 12:39:34 2022 +0100"
  },
  "committer": {
    "name": "Jacek Centkowski",
    "email": "geminica.programs@gmail.com",
    "time": "Wed Mar 09 17:11:31 2022 +0100"
  },
  "message": "Limit \u0027maxPages\u0027 to \u0027100\u0027 by deafult\n\nIt seems that Lucene implementation has to scan through the large amount\nof data in order to reach distant page and results in substantial amount\nof memory being used (results in OOO exception). In order to mitigate it\nlimit \u0027maxPages\u0027 to `100\u0027 if no value is set. Note that one can still\nset it to unlimited by changing the value to \u00270\u0027.\n\nRelease-Notes: Limit \u0027index.maxPages\u0027 to \u0027100\u0027 by default\nBug: Issue 15563\nChange-Id: I5a9a50b755d9814fcdd47910702b8ec80b2a029f\n",
  "tree_diff": [
    {
      "type": "modify",
      "old_id": "10baed2750e999f932bed5c12ea14dbfd5abfc17",
      "old_mode": 33188,
      "old_path": "Documentation/config-gerrit.txt",
      "new_id": "31bb6be4806a6cd5b661a300eaa5580a391e4f64",
      "new_mode": 33188,
      "new_path": "Documentation/config-gerrit.txt"
    },
    {
      "type": "modify",
      "old_id": "29b8ea657ef1dd745905a6f503e8e8d88bb7b398",
      "old_mode": 33188,
      "old_path": "java/com/google/gerrit/index/IndexConfig.java",
      "new_id": "c93c5393c265179b9a60d284cdbfc0ca37fb57a3",
      "new_mode": 33188,
      "new_path": "java/com/google/gerrit/index/IndexConfig.java"
    },
    {
      "type": "add",
      "old_id": "0000000000000000000000000000000000000000",
      "old_mode": 0,
      "old_path": "/dev/null",
      "new_id": "6d3fcb7024f8cbc3244fc9840e9ae1daecd4e708",
      "new_mode": 33188,
      "new_path": "javatests/com/google/gerrit/index/IndexConfigTest.java"
    }
  ]
}
